Tasting Notes: This wine has a superb balance with hints of black fruits and spices, the balance and the delicacy of the tannins make it an elegant wine. Winemaking: Grape harvesting is done manually. Grapes are completely destemmed. Fermentation lasts over 3 to 4
weeks on an average, traditional winemaking makes use of indigenous
yeasts only. Grapes are pressed in a traditional wooden vertical press. The wine is not filtered, not
fined; one part remains in oak barrels for 9 to 18 months and the other
part in tanks.
Coup de Coeur in the 2013 Guide Hachette
"Serge Depeyre and Brigitte Bile have since 2002 directed this 13
hectare domaine on a terroir composed of clay-limestone and black
schists. Syrah, grenache and carignan have found this a great place to
express themselves, as witnessed by this cuvée which is perfect in every
way. The robe is a dark cherry color. The nose, very open, mixes
violet, black fruits and sweet spices. A supple and silky entry lead to a
powerful mouth without any heaviness, rich, ample, and dense, carpeted
with aromas of licorice, vanilla and jammy red fruits and built on very
finely grained tannins. A wine with great intensity to be tasted over
the next 3 to 5 years with a tasty lamb dish."
